What customers are saying

The 2018 Hyundai Tucson offers commendable fuel economy, interior space, and value, making it a competitive midsize SUV. However, mixed feedback highlights concerns about engine power, cabin noise, and technology limitations. Customers valued its reliability and smooth ride but noted issues with handling, cargo space, and maintenance costs. Overall satisfaction is moderate, balancing pros like affordable pricing with cons like limited pickup and noisiness.

2018 Hyundai Tucson FAQs

The 2018 Hyundai Tucson has a maximum towing capacity of 1000 pounds, when properly equipped. Various factors may impact towing capacity, including weight of passengers, cargo, and options/accessories.

The 2018 Hyundai Tucson offers the following fuel efficiency options: • Gas: 25 city / 30 highway MPG (Limited trim) • Gas: 23 city / 30 highway MPG (SE trim) • Gas: 23 city / 30 highway MPG (SEL Plus trim) • Gas: 23 city / 30 highway MPG (SEL trim) • Gas: 25 city / 30 highway MPG (Value trim) • Gas: 21 city / 28 highway MPG (Sport trim) Actual mileage may vary based on driving conditions, vehicle condition, and driving habits.
